S NO
Name of NARCOTIC DRUGS and its salts and preparations, admixtures extracts or other substances containing any of these drugs
1*
(+)-4-dimethylamino-1, 2-diphelyl-3-methyl-2butanol propionate, (the international non-proprietary name of which is Dextropoxyphene)
2 (+)-alpha-3-acefoxy-6-methyamino-4,4-diphenylhbeptane(the international non-proprietary name ow hich is Noracymethadol)
3 (+)-ethyl trans-2-(dimethylamino)-1-phenyl-5-cyclohexneโ€“carboxylate, (the international non-proprietary name of which is Tilidine)
4 (-)-3-hydroxymorphinan the international non-proprietary name of which is Norlevorphanol)
5 (โ€“)-3hydroxy-N-phenacylmorphinan(the international non-proprietary name of which is Levophenacylmorphan)
6 03-acetyl-7,8-dihydro-7[I-(r) hydroxy 1-1- methylbutyl] O-6 methyl-6, 14-endoethe nomoryhine, (the international non-proprietary name of which is Acetorphine)
7 1(2-benzyloxyethyl-3-4-phenylpiperidine-4-carboxylic acid ethyl ester (the international non-proprietary name of which is Benzethidine)
8 1,2,3,4,5,6-hexahydro 8-hydroxy-3,6,11-trimethyl-2,6-methano-3-benzazocine (the international non-proprietary name of which is Metazocine)
9 1,2,3,4,5,6-hexahydro-8-hydroxy-6,11-dimethyl-3-phenethyl-2-, 6-methano-3-benzazocine(also known as N.I.H.),7519, the international non-proprietary name of which is Phenazocine)
10 1,2,5-trimethyl-4-phenyl-4-propionoxypiperidine (known as Trimeperidine)
11 1,3-dimethyl-4-phenyl-4-propionoxyhexamethyleneimine (Proheptazine).
12 1-(2-morpholinoethyl)-4-phenylpiperidine-4-carboxylic acid, ethyl ester (known as Morpheridine)
13 1-(2-tetrahydrofurfuryloxyethyl)-4-phenyl piperidine-4-carboxylic acid ethyl ester (the international non-proprietary name of which is Furethidine)
1-methyl-4-(3-hydroxyphenly)-peperdine-4-carboxylic acid ethyl ester otherwise known as 1-methyl-4-metahydroxyphenil peperidine-4-carboxylic acid ethyl ester) and its salts (bemidone and the like)
20* 1-methyl-4-phenyl-piperidine-4-carboxylic acit ethyl ester (commonly known as โ€˜Pethidineโ€™ and its salts (such as Antiduol, Biphenal, Centralgin, D-140, Demerol, Dispadol, Dodonal, Dolantal, Donlatin, Dolntol, Dolaren, Dolarin, Dolatul, Dolental, Dolintal,
21 1-methyl-4-phenylpiperidine 4-carboxylic acid ( forpurposes of narcotic control, the designation Pethidine-Intermediate-C is suggested by the W.H.O.)
22** 1-phenethyl-1-4-N. propionylanilino-piperidine (the international-non-proprietary name of which is Fentanyl
23 1/3-cyano-3, 3-diphenylpropyl)-4-(1-piperidine piperidine-4-carboxylic acid amide (the international non-proprietary name of which is Piritramide )
24 1[2-(2-hydroxyethoxy)-ethyl]-4-Phenylpiperidine-4-carleovylic acid ethyl ester (known as Etoxeridine)
25 14-hydroxydihydromorphine (the international non-proprietary name of which is Hydromorphinol)
26 2(p-chlorbenzyl)1-diethylamino-ethyl-5 nitrobenzimidazole) the international non-proprietary name of which is Etonitazena)
27 2-Methyl-3-morpholine-1,1-diphenylpropanecarboxylic acid (for purposes of narcotics control, the designation Moramide intermediate is suggested by the (W.H.O.)
28 2-p-ethoxybenzyl)-1-diethylaminoethyl 5-nitrobenzimidazole (the internation non-proprietary name of which is Etonitazene)
29 3,4-dimethoxy-17-methylmorphinen-c,B,14 diol (the international non-propreitary name of which is Drotebanol)
30 3-ally-1-methyl-4-phenyl-4-propionxy piperidine (the international non-proprietary name of which is Allylprodine)
31 3-dimethyl-amino 1,1-di (2-Thienly) 1-butene ; 3-Ethyl-methyl-amino-1, 1-di(2-Thienyl)-1 butene; 3-diethylamino-1, 1-di(2-Thienyl)-1-butene, (also known as Diethyl-thiam-butene and as Themalone)
32 3-hydroxy-N-phenethylmorphinan (Phenomorphan).
33 4, 4-diphenyl-6-morpholine-heptanone-3(otherwise known as 6-mrpholine 4, diphenyl-3-heptanone and as Phenadoxone and its salts (such as CB-II, Hepagin, Heptalgin, Heptalin, Heptazone and the like
34 4,4-diphenyl-6 piperidine 3-hexanone(the international non-proprietary name of which is Norpipanone)
35 4-4-diphenyl-6-dimethylamino-heptanone-3 (otherwise known as 6-dimethyl amino 4 : 4-diphenyl-3-heptanone and as Methadone and its salts such as (Adanon, Algolysin, Amidone Amdosan, Butalgin, Depridol, Diaminon, Dianone, Dolafin, Dolamid, Dolphine, Doriexo
36 4-cyano-1-methyl-4-pehnylpiperidine ( for purpose of narcotics control the designation Pethidine-intermediate-A is suggested by (W.H.O.)
37 4-cyano-2-dimethylamino;4-diphenylbutane(for purpose of narcotics control the designation Methadone intermediate is suggested by the (W.H.O.)
38 4-Morpholine-2,2-Diphenly ethyl butyrate (Dioxaphenyl Butyrate).
39 4-phenylpiperidine 4 carboxylic acid ethyl ester (the designation of which for purposes of narcotic control, had been suggested by the W.H.O. as Pethidine Intermediate-B)
40 4:4-diphenyl-5-methyl-6-dimethyl-aminohexanone-3(othersie known as 6-dimethylamino-5-methyl-4 : diphenyl-3-hexanone and as Isomethadone)
41 4:4-diphenyl-6-piperidine-3-heptanone (Dipipanone).
42 4:4diphenyl 6-dimethyl-amino-3-hexanone (also known as Normethadone)
43 6-methyl-6-dihydromorhpine
44 6-methyl-6desoxy morphine
45 6-nicotinylcodeine(the international non-proprietary name of which is Nicocodine)
46 6-nicotinyldihydrocodeine, the international non-proprietary name of which is Nicodicodine)
47 7,8-dihydro-7-[1-(R)-hydroxy-1-methylbuty]. O-methyl-6,14-endoethenomorphine, (the international non-proprietary name of which is Etorphine)
48 Acetyldihydrocodeinone (commonly known as โ€˜Acetylodihydrocodeinoneโ€™ and Acetyldemethylo dihydrothe, baine) : its salts (such as Acedicone Novocodon and the like)
49 All the salts and esters of Ecgonine
50 Alpha-1-3-dimethyl-4-phenyl-4-propionoxy peperidine (commonly known as Alphaprodine) and it salts (such as Nisentil, Nisintil, NU-1196 and the like)
51 Alpha-1-methyl-3-ethyl-4-phenyl-4-propionoxypiperidine (also known as N.I.H.-7315; the international non-proprietary name bein Alphameprodine).
52 Benzyl-morphine (of which Peronine is a salt ) and all โ€œ>D-3-methyl,2,2-diphenyl-4-morpholine outyrylpyrrolidine(known as Dextromoamide) and its salts, as well as the raceimicramide) and its slats and also the levorotatory form of the drug ( known as levomoramied)
59 Dihydrocodeinone (commonly known as Hydrocodone), its salts (such as Dicodide, Codinovo, Diconone, Hycodan, Multacodin, Nyodide, Ydroced and the like) and its esters and salts of its esters,
60 Dihydrocodine and Acetyldihydrocodeine, other derivatives of Dihydrocoedeine and their salts such as, Paracodine and Acetyl Codone and the like)
61 Dihydrodeoxymorphine; its salts (such as Desomorphine, Permonid, Scopermid and the like)
62 Dihydrohydroxy Codeinone (commonly known as โ€˜Oxy-Codone and Dihydroxycodeinone) : its salts (such as Eucodal Boncodal Dinarcon Hydrolaudin, Nucodan, Percodan, Scophedal, Tebodol and the like)
63 Dihydrohydroxymorphinone
64 Dihydromorphine ; its salts (such as Paramorfan and the like)
65 Dihydromorphinone (commonly known as โ€˜Hydromorphone) its salts (such as Dilaudide, Dimorphid, Novolaudon and the like)
66 Dihydroxy-dihydromorphinone
67 Dimethylamionethyl-ethoyx-1,diphenylacetate (the international non-proprietary name of which is Dimenoxadol)
68* Ethyl 1-(3-Cyano-3, 3-diphenylpropyl) -4-phenylpiperidine-4-carboxylic acid ethyl ester (the international non-proprietary name of which is Diphenoxylate)
69 I[ 2-(p-Aminophenly)-ethyl]-4-carbethoxy-4-phenly-piperidine otherwise known as 1-[2-(p-aminophenyl)-ethyl]-4-phenyl-piperidine-4-carboxylic acid ethyl ester)
70 Isopropyl and other esters of 1-methyl-4-phenyl piperidine-4-carboxylic acid
71** Methyl morphine (commonly known as โ€˜Codeineโ€™) and Ethyl morphine and their salts (including Dionine), all dilutions and preparations except those which are compounded with one or more other ingredients and containing not more than 100 milligrammes
72 Methyldihydromorphinone (commonly known as โ€˜Metoponโ€™)
73 Morphine-Nโ€“Oxide (commonly known a โ€˜Genomorphineโ€™ and โ€˜N-Oxy-morphine), the Morphine-N-Oxide derivatives and the other pentavalent nitrogen morphine drivatives
74 Myristryl ester of benzylmorphine (the international non-proprietary name of which is Myrophine)
75 N-(1-methyl 2-piperidinoethyl)-N-2-pyridylpropnamide (the international non-proprietary name of which is Propiram)
76 N-(2(1-methylpiperid-2-yl) ethyl-propionanilide (the international non-proprietary name of which is Phenampromide)
77 N-[-1-2-(4-ethyl-4, 51 dihydro-5 oxo-III-tetraxol-l-yl) ethyl]-4-(methoxymethyl), [4-Peperidinyl].
78 N-[2-(9methylphenethylamino) propyl] propionanilide (the international (non-proprietary name of which is Diampromide)
79 N-[4-(methoxymethyl)-1[2-(2-thienyl)-ethyl) [4-piperidyl] Propionanilide (the international non-proprietary name of which is Sufentanil)
80 Racemic, Dextro and Laevo forms of Alpha-6-dimethyl-amino 4: 4-diphenyl-3-acetoxy heptane (commonly known as โ€˜ alpha-Acetyl Methadolโ€™); Racemic, Dextro and Laevo forms of Beta-6-dimethylamino-4: 4-diphenyl-3-acetoxy heptane(commonly known as โ€˜Beta-Acetyl)
87 Recemic, Dextro and Laevo forms of Alpha-6-dimethyl amino 4-diphenyl-3-hentanol (commonly known as Alpha-Methadol); Racemic, Dextro and Laevo forms of Beta-6-dimethyl-amino-4 ; 4-diphenyl-3-heptanol (commonly known as โ€˜ Beta-Methadolโ€™
